xc60 drive e 2010 timing belt and aux belt
hi all.... hope im in the right place.....im struggling to find the right info anywhere. i have a diesel 2.4 xc60 drive e bought in 2010. its just hit 108,000miles. from what ive gathered it needs a new timing belt and aux belt. the local garage can change this for me, but from doing more research iv found people saying that you need to change the pullys for the aux belt aswell. but the garage is just recommending changing the belt. elsewhere if read that there are two aux belts.... upper and lower.... ? im just at a loss as to know what should be done. can anyone offer me a definitive guide as to what needs replacing so that i can ask for it all to be done at the same time.
many thanks for any help |

The cam belt, the cambelt tensioner The Cam belt idler wheel This is all in the volvo cambelt kit also the aux belt the aux belt tensioner and securing screw .. 25nm tightening torque do not overtighten And the AC Compressor stretch belt Use Volvo Genuine Parts ... and all ok until 54000 miles time when just the AUX belt must be changed ..

remember the Aux Belt tensioner bolt must be 25 nm tell who ever is doing it ... if it snaps your engine is wrecked .. That is why i would always recommend someone with experience of this job to do it . I had better mention that the 4 crankshaft pulley bolts must be renewed too , and they are angle torqued which may be another unfamiliar job to some people .
